PRAYER TO ST. KATERI

O Saint Kateri, Lily of the Mohawks,
Your love for Jesus,
so strong, so steadfast,
pray that we may become like you.

Your short and painful life
showed us your strength and humility.
Pray that we may become
forever humble like you.

Like the bright and shining stars at night,
we pray that your light
may forever shine down upon us,
giving light, hope, peacefulness
and serenity in our darkest moments.

Fill our hearts, Saint Kateri Tekakwitha
with your same love for Jesus
and pray that we may have the strength and courage
to become one like you in Heaven.
Through Christ our Lord. Amen.

ADVANTAGES OF FIBERGLASS VS. CONCRETE OUTDOOR STATUES :


• WEIGHT - Fiberglass is light. Even the largest sizes can be easily carried by one or two people. Concrete requires a crane for placement at the site for the larger sizes.



• SHIPPING - Fiberglass is light. It costs considerably less to ship than concrete statues.



• PRECISE - Fiberglass pours as a liquid and therefore reflects all the fine details of the mold. Concrete is thick and grainy and does not penetrate into the fine details of the mold well.



• STRENGTH - Fiberglass is strong. It is reinforced and is the same material used to make boat hulls which withstand shock and the elements without breaking. Although concrete is durable for outdoors, it will break into pieces if hit or knocked over.



• COST - Fiberglass is a much less expensive medium for outdoor statues than is concrete.



• DURABILITY - Fiberglass will not degrade, erode or crumble over time in the elements like concrete tends to do.



• AVAILABILITY - Concrete statues take longer to prep, produce, cure and finish, where the fiberglass process allows for quicker turnaround.
